The following table prov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ies with a requirement for Vite skills. Included is a benchmarking guide to the salaries offered in vacancies that have cited Vite over the 6 months to 27 April 2024 with a comparison to the same period in the previous 2 years.

6 months to
27 Apr 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 881 964 1206
Rank change year-on-year +83 +242 -
Permanent jobs citing Vite 15 6 26
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in the UK 0.015% 0.006% 0.017%
As % of the Development Applications category 0.16% 0.039% 0.076%
Number of salaries quoted 15 6 5
10th Percentile £45,000 £37,875 -
25th Percentile £53,125 £40,188 £35,000
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£60,000 £47,750 £40,000
Median % change year-on-year +25.65% +19.38% -
75th Percentile £73,125 £50,188 £57,500
90th Percentile £83,000 £52,625 -
UK excluding London median annual salary £60,000 £47,750 £35,000
% change year-on-year +25.65% +36.43% -
